Quote meaning
When you hear that without shadows, there's no light, it's a reminder that life isn’t just about the good times. Light, or the good stuff, only truly exists because we have challenges, or shadows, to contrast it with. You can't have one without the other. The presence of obstacles or tough times means you're experiencing life fully, with all its highs and lows.

Think back to the Great Depression. It was one of the darkest periods in modern history with widespread poverty and hardship. But from that time came stories of resilience, innovation, and profound change. People found ways to survive, adapt, and even thrive despite immense difficulties. The shadows of that era highlighted the light of human spirit and ingenuity.

Let’s bring it closer to home. Picture a student struggling through the rigors of medical school. Sleepless nights, relentless exams, and the pressure of holding people's lives in their hands—it's a tough journey. But those very challenges forge competent, compassionate doctors who save lives and make critical decisions. The shadows of their training years cast a light on their future roles as healers.

So, how can you apply this wisdom? Simple. Embrace your struggles. When you’re in the middle of a tough situation, remember that these dark moments are part of the process. They’re shaping you, preparing you for something brighter. Don’t shy away from the shadows—face them. They’re a sign you’re moving towards the light, growing, and learning.

Imagine a marathoner. At mile 20, their legs are screaming, and they’re questioning why they ever thought this was a good idea. But they push through. That pain, the shadows of the race, are temporary. Crossing the finish line, the sense of achievement, the light, is permanent. It's a hard-earned victory made all the sweeter by the struggle.

Let’s break it down in a way that’s even more personal. Think of a time you faced a significant challenge. Maybe you lost a job, went through a breakup, or dealt with an illness. Those were your shadows. But what came after? Perhaps you found a better job, met someone who truly appreciates you, or discovered a new love for life and health. The light was there waiting for you, made all the more beautiful because you went through the darkness to get to it.

In a nutshell, the shadows we face are not just inevitable but essential. They make the light moments in our lives meaningful. So next time you find yourself in a dark place, remember—you're in the light. It's just that the shadows are making sure you appreciate every bit of it. And tell yourself this: If I’m facing shadows, I’m heading in the right direction. The light is just around the corner.
